Currently, we are seeking a Clinic Operation Manager to join our team.
Responsibilities :
Oversee the day-to-day operations of the clinic to ensure smooth, efficient, and high-quality healthcare services.
Lead, supervise, and develop clinic staff, including nurses, medical assistants, receptionists, and administrative personnel.
Monitor clinic performance by tracking operational KPIs, patient satisfaction, appointment flow, and service quality.
Develop, implement, and continuously improve clinic SOPs, workflows, and operational processes.
Ensure compliance with Ministry of Health (MOH) regulations, licensing requirements, infection control standards, and workplace safety policies.
Manage staff scheduling, attendance, manpower planning, and resource allocation to ensure adequate daily coverage.
Monitor inventory levels of medicines, medical supplies, and equipment, ensuring timely procurement and cost-effective stock management.
Handle patient feedback, complaints, and service recovery professionally to maintain high patient satisfaction.
Collaborate closely with doctors and department heads to improve clinical operations and patient outcomes.
Prepare operational reports, analyze clinic performance, and recommend continuous improvement initiatives.
Manage clinic budgets, operational expenses, and cost-control measures to achieve financial targets.
Support recruitment, onboarding, performance management, and staff training to build a high-performing healthcare team.
